THE misery is finally over. The contraflows which have blighted the lives of motorists on the A338 Spur Road have gone.

Commuters breathed a sigh of relief today as roadworks on the dual carriageway finished three weeks early.

But one of the four sliproads at the Blackwater Junction will remain closed until early December because work is continuing at Hurn Road.

Temporary traffic lights and speed restrictions will stay in place on Hurn Road until early next month while the final part of the project is finished.

The northbound sliproad leading off towards Hurn will stay shut until the work is done.

Dorset County Council's head of highways client services David Gibb said: "I'd like to remind drivers going through the Hurn Road works that they should slow right down and be patient. It's tight across the bridge and we've seen people jumping the red light, desperate to get through."
